Tokyo Midtown Yaesu complex to open in 2022

Mitsui Fudosan Co. will open Tokyo Midtown Yaesu, a large complex featuring office and commercial facilities, in the Yaesu district of Chuo Ward, Tokyo, at the end of August 2022, the property developer has announced.

Located in front of JR Tokyo Station's Yaesu South Exit, the complex will connect directly to Tokyo Station via an underground mall. It will occupy 1.5 hectares and comprise a skyscraper about 240 meters high and another 41-meter high building.

The top 39th to 45th floors of the skyscraper will house a Bulgari Hotel, a luxury hotel chain opening its first hotel in Japan. The first to fourth floors of the building will house a public elementary school.

This is the third large-scale redevelopment project in Tokyo under the name of "Tokyo Midtown," following Tokyo Midtown in Minato Ward and Tokyo Midtown Hibiya in Chiyoda Ward.
